Examining Your Irrigation System?

Is your sprinkler system quiet? Don't fret, there are a few common reasons why this might be happening. First, check your timer. Make sure it's configured correctly and that the system is activated.

Next, examine your sprinkler emitters. Look for any blockages that might be preventing water from flowing. Also, confirm that the controls are fully unrestricted. If you're still having trouble, it might be time to call a professional irrigation specialist.

They can identify the fault and get your system flowing smoothly back to normal.

Overcoming Weak Water Pressure: Restore Your Irrigation System

Are you struggling against low water pressure in your irrigation system? It can be a annoying problem, leaving your lawn thirsty and appearing stressed. But don't worry! There are a few steps you can take to figure out the root cause of the issue and get your irrigation flowing once more.

Here are a few common culprits behind low water pressure:

  • Clogged sprinkler heads or nozzles can significantly reduce the water flow.
  • Broken pipes can lead to pressure loss over time.
  • A faulty backflow preventer can also restrict water flow.

Once you've determined the problem area, you can start resolving the issue.

End the Drips: How to Fix a Leaky Sprinkler Head

A leaky sprinkler head is more than just an annoyance—it's a waste of precious liquid. Fortunately, fixing a leaky sprinkler head is often a simple task you can tackle yourself. First, identify the malfunction. Is the head spraying randomly? Or is there a constant drip? Once you know what you're dealing with, follow these easy steps to fix your sprinkler system.

  • Disengage the water supply to your sprinkler system.
  • Detach the leaky sprinkler head from the riser using a screwdriver.
  • Check the mechanism of the head for deterioration.
  • Swap any damaged parts with new ones. Often, a simple replacement of the jet will fix the problem.
  • Reconnect the head to the riser and tighten it using your screwdriver.
  • Activate the water supply and inspect your repaired sprinkler head.

Frequent Irrigation Problems and Easy Fixes

Watering your garden is a crucial part of keeping your plants healthy and thriving, but sometimes irrigation can present some challenges. Unforeseen issues can pop up that leave you with wilting flowers or struggling veggies. Don't worry, though! Many common irrigation problems have simple fixes.

Here are a few problems to watch out for and how to tackle them:

* **Leaking Pipes:** A leaking pipe is a typical problem that can waste water and harm your garden. Inspect your irrigation system regularly for leaks and replace any damaged sections promptly.

* **Clogged Sprinkler Heads:** Over time, debris can build up in sprinkler heads, reducing water flow. Regularly clean your sprinkler heads by removing the nozzles and flushing them with a cleaning solution.

* **Uneven Watering:** If some areas of your garden are getting more water than others, it could be because your sprinklers aren't positioned correctly or your system has blockages. Adjust sprinkler placement and confirm proper water distribution.

By keeping an eye out for these common problems and taking quick action, you can keep your irrigation system running smoothly and your garden thriving.
